Comprehending Tradition Systems
Legacy systems are typically defined as outdated computing software application and hardware that are still in use, in spite of the availability of more recent technology. These systems can be deeply deep-rooted in an organization's operations, making them challenging to replace. According to a report by the International Data Corporation (IDC), nearly 70% of IT budget plans are still allocated to preserving legacy systems, which prevents innovation and dexterity.
The disadvantages of tradition systems are manifold. They can cause increased operational costs, lowered efficiency, and a lack of flexibility in reacting to market changes. Additionally, as businesses grow, these out-of-date systems can end up being bottlenecks, preventing scalability and preventing the ability to leverage data efficiently.
The Shift to Agile IT Infrastructure
Agile IT infrastructure is identified by its flexibility, scalability, and responsiveness to alter. It permits organizations to adjust quickly to market demands and technological developments. A study conducted by McKinsey & Business discovered that organizations that adopt nimble practices can improve their time-to-market by approximately 50%, considerably improving their one-upmanship.
Transitioning to a nimble infrastructure normally involves several key components:
Cloud Computing: Welcoming cloud technology is essential in improving IT infrastructure. According to Gartner, the worldwide public cloud services market is projected to grow to $623.3 billion by 2023. Cloud services provide scalability, cost-efficiency, and boosted partnership, allowing businesses to react to changing needs promptly.
Microservices Architecture: This approach breaks down applications into smaller sized, independent services that can be established, deployed, and scaled individually. A study by the Cloud Native Computing Structure (CNCF) exposed that organizations adopting microservices architecture report a 20% increase in deployment frequency and a 30% enhancement in lead time for changes.
DevOps Practices: Integrating development and operations groups promotes a culture of partnership and continuous enhancement. Case Studies in Modernization
Several companies have actually successfully transitioned from tradition systems to nimble infrastructures, showcasing the advantages of modernization.
General Electric (GE): GE executed a cloud-based service that allowed them to streamline operations and enhance data accessibility. By embracing agile practices, GE minimized the time it required to establish new items and services, leading to a significant boost in market responsiveness.
Netflix: Initially built on a monolithic architecture, Netflix transitioned to microservices, enabling them to scale rapidly and innovate continually. This shift allowed Netflix to deploy changes to its platform every couple of seconds, improving user experience and satisfaction.
Target: Target's modernization efforts included a comprehensive overhaul of its IT infrastructure, focusing on cloud computing and data analytics. As an outcome, the business improved its stock management and client engagement methods, causing increased sales and client loyalty.
Difficulties in the Shift
While the benefits of modernizing IT infrastructure are clear, organizations might face challenges throughout the shift. Resistance to alter, absence of knowledgeable workers, and spending plan constraints can hinder development. A report by Deloitte discovered that 70% of digital changes stop working, often due to inadequate change management and management assistance.
To reduce these obstacles, organizations ought to prioritize:
Modification Management: Establishing a robust modification management technique is essential. This includes appealing stakeholders, communicating the benefits of modernization, and providing training and assistance to employees.
Financial investment in Talent: Organizations should invest in upskilling their workforce to ensure they have the necessary abilities to operate in an agile environment. Partnering with business and technology consulting companies can supply access to proficiency and training resources.
Iterative Method: Rather than trying a complete overhaul, organizations can adopt an iterative method to modernization. This enables for gradual execution, decreasing disturbance and enabling constant feedback and enhancement.
